Gut check: dialysis Patients' microbiome under the microscope
NCT ID NCT06877585
First seen Jun 27, 2026 · Last updated Jun 27, 2026
Summary
This study looked at 58 adults on hemodialysis to understand how the mix of bacteria in their gut relates to waste products in their blood. Researchers measured different types of gut bacteria and chemicals they produce, like short-chain fatty acids and uremic toxins. The goal was to learn more about these connections, not to test a new treatment.
